In 2024, Nigeria continued to see a significant influx of brominated vegetable oil (BVO) imports, with top exporters including China, India, Metropolitan France, Netherlands, and Portugal. The market concentration, as measured by the Herfindahl-Hirschman Index (HHI), remained very high, indicating strong dominance by key players.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) from 2020 to 2024 stood at an impressive 12.9%, with a notable growth spurt of 23.63% from 2023 to 2024, underscoring the increasing demand for BVO in Nigeria`s market.
